I picked this up on a whim at the library and for the first 50 pages, I wasn’t so sure about it. By the end of this first volume, I was smiling and really enjoying the read.
I Think Our Son is Gay is a very well illustrated manga that does not overly rely on exposition. The story is told from the point of you of the mother, which I really enjoyed. For the first half, the characters felt very flat and simple. I was unsure about reading.
In the second half, the character development improved and we saw more depth from the mother and the eldest son. There was also significant development of the father’s perspective. I am hoping for more development of the younger brother in future volumes.
I mean if you’re looking for queer positive representation in manga and a fun read, this is a good choice.
